Output 1086df6009742db15343b37efaa953ea5a5f22931f952710c8c1a78054a3c87a:2

value
26350992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ce213b38a53bdcd725626e613ac71b36f410649 OP_EQUAL
address
MLk5fPWVCcNWKivxpt1QRApckZuBJDZW28
transaction
1086df6009742db15343b37efaa953ea5a5f22931f952710c8c1a78054a3c87a
spent
true